Title, Youth Tried as Adults: Life Sentences, Trauma, and the Failure of America’s Juvenile Justice System

Children and teenagers in the United States are still being sentenced to die in prison. Youth under the age of 18 can receive life sentences, including life without the possibility of parole (in 11 states, this can happen as young as 8 years old).

In 2012, the U.S. Supreme Court ruled in Miller v. Alabama that mandatory life‑without‑parole sentences for juveniles are unconstitutional because they violate the Eighth Amendment’s prohibition on cruel and unusual punishment. The Court left open the possibility that judges may still impose discretionary life without parole on youth convicted of homicide, but only after considering age, trauma, and other mitigating factors.sentencingproject+1

Even after Miller and related decisions, the United States remains the only country in the world that still sentences people to life without parole for crimes committed before age 18.

How many children and former children are serving life?

When Miller was decided, about 2,800 people were serving juvenile life without parole (JLWOP) for crimes they committed as minors. A 2016 snapshot put the number of children and juveniles serving JLWOP at roughly 2,310.[original text] Since then, resentencings and reforms have reduced that population: more than 900 individuals previously condemned to die in prison as juveniles have now been released, often after decades behind bars.

But JLWOP is only the tip of the iceberg.

  • As of 2023, one major national analysis found that 1 in 6 people in U.S. prisons, nearly 200,000 people, are serving some form of life sentence (LWOP, life with parole, or “virtual life” terms of 50+ years).
  • A significant share of those life sentences were imposed for crimes committed while the person was under 18 or in their late teens and early twenties.
  • Beyond JLWOP, thousands of people are serving life with parole for crimes committed as juveniles; estimates in the early 2020s put that number at over 7,000 nationwide.[original text] These “life with parole” terms often require 25–50 years before the first parole hearing, functioning as de facto life sentences for many.

In 2021, there were still around 300 children and juveniles incarcerated in adult prisons after being prosecuted as adults. The U.S. has reduced the number of children charged as adults from over 250,000 per year in the early 2000s to about 53,000 today, but that is still an enormous pipeline of children into adult systems that were never designed for them.

A key multistate study (based on 2014 data, still the most detailed breakdown of adult‑court filings) found.

  • Across 23 states, there were 37,941 youth cases filed in adult court in the year studied.

  • Of the 23,553 cases they could fully trace, 15,410 (about two‑thirds) came from just three states: Michigan, North Carolina, and Florida.

  • Florida remains a standout; over just five years, 4,446 children were charged as adults, more than any other state, largely via prosecutor “direct file.

  • Michigan and North Carolina also continue to appear as heavy users of transfer/auto‑charge relative to their youth populations.

Who can be tried as an adult, and how young?

Today, 11 states, Alaska, Florida, Hawaii, Idaho, Maine, Michigan, Pennsylvania, Rhode Island, South Carolina, Tennessee, and West Virginia, have no minimum age specified in law for trying a child as an adult. Children as young as eight have been, and can be, charged as adults in some of these states.

At the same time, some states are moving in the opposite direction. In 2023, Massachusetts became a pioneering state court jurisdiction to prohibit life without parole for “emerging adults” ages 18–20, and in 2024–2025, Hawaii passed a law banning life without parole for anyone who was under 21 at the time of the offense. Hawaii also set a minimum age of 12 for juvenile court jurisdiction, recognizing that very young children should not be pulled into criminal courts at all.

Some states raising protections for youth and emerging adults, others retaining or expanding harsh sentencing, mean that a child’s fate can depend heavily on the state line they happen to cross.

Supreme Court rulings: progress and pushback

Over the past two decades, the Supreme Court has issued a series of decisions that acknowledge a basic truth: children are different” for purposes of criminal punishment.

Key cases include:

  • Roper v. Simmons (2005): Banned the death penalty for crimes committed under age 18.
  • Graham v. Florida (2010): Banned life without parole for juveniles convicted of non‑homicide offenses.law.
  • Miller v. Alabama (2012): Banned mandatory life without parole for juveniles in homicide cases; judges must consider youth and mitigating factors.
  • Montgomery v. Louisiana (2016): Made Miller retroactive, leading to resentencing and releases for many people who had been sentenced to JLWOP as children.
  • Jones v. Mississippi (2021): Pulled back, holding that judges do not need to make a specific finding that a youth is “permanently incorrigible” before imposing life without parole, so long as they had discretion and considered age.pbs+1

Advocates argue that Jones makes it easier again to sentence minors to life without parole despite the science of adolescent brain development and trauma.

Real stories: kids sentenced to die in prison

Behind every statistic is a child whose brain, life circumstances, and environment made them especially vulnerable to terrible decisions.

  • In Michigan, Dakotah Eliason was sentenced to life without parole for killing his grandfather at age 14; his case helped highlight Miller’s impact and the question of whether mandatory JLWOP can ever be just.newyorker
  • In a Florida case, Joe Sullivan was 13 when he was sentenced to life without parole for a non‑homicide sexual assault; he was one of only two known 13‑year‑olds in the country given JLWOP for a non‑homicide crime at that time.law.nyu+1

These stories are not outliers, they reveal how trauma, poverty, and lack of support intersect with harsh laws to produce sentences that write off a child’s entire future.

What adult prisons do to children

Prisons are dangerous places for young people. Children in adult prisons are raped and beaten at 3 to 5 times the rate of adults, according to multiple advocacy and government sources. To “protect” them, facilities often resort to solitary confinement, putting kids alone in cells for 22–23 hours a day, an approach that is extremely traumatizing and associated with lasting mental illness, self‑harm, and suicide.

Adult prisons almost never provide what children need to grow and change:

  • Education tailored to adolescents
  • Age‑appropriate mental health treatment for trauma, depression, and PTSD
  • Rehabilitative programming focused on development, not warehousing

Studies following youth who were incarcerated as adults show they have significantly worse physical and mental health outcomes decades later than similar youth processed through juvenile systems, higher rates of hypertension, obesity, functional limitations, and serious psychiatric disorders.

Recidivism: we are creating more crime, not less

Youth prosecuted as adults have higher rates of re‑arrest and reincarceration than youth kept in juvenile courts, even when controlling for offense type and prior record. Adult prisons harden kids, deepen trauma, and surround them with older people skilled in violence and crime. The cost of these practices is enormous. Racial injustice: which kids are punished most harshly?

Youth of color, especially Black children, are disproportionately:

  • Charged as adults
  • Given extreme sentences (including JLWOP and de facto life terms)
  • Confined in the harshest adult‑system environments

This happens even when the underlying conduct is similar to that of white youth. These disparities are not an accident; they reflect generations of unequal policing, prosecution, and resource allocation.

Trauma, toxic homes, and the “poor child to felon” pipeline

Minnesota Supreme Court Chief Justice Kathleen Blatz famously said,

“The difference between that poor child and a felon is about eight years.”

She was describing what every experienced child advocate sees: children raised in toxic homes, exposed to untreated trauma, are on a short and predictable path from victim to defendant. Childhood trauma changes brain development, impulse control, and emotional regulation. If left untreated, it becomes mental illness, substance use, and behavior problems that can last a lifetime.

Signs of hope: reform and resistance

There are concrete signs of progress:

  • 25 states and D.C. now ban juvenile life without parole, and another 7 states have no youth currently serving JLWOP, effectively abandoning the sentence.
  • States like Massachusetts and Hawaii are extending protections into the early twenties, recognizing “emerging adults” as developmentally closer to youth than older adults.
  • The U.S. Justice Department has invested more than $130 million in recent years to support youth violence prevention, juvenile system reform, mentoring, and reentry programs across the country.

But these reforms are uneven, often fragile, and sometimes under attack. The mix of articles and reports gathered here offers only a snapshot of what is happening across the nation in juvenile justice, and what is at stake if we fail to see abused, traumatized children as children first.
